Job Description

The Project Manager will be responsible for :

  • Monitor the progress, performance, and quality of the project(s).
  • Lead project meetings, including reporting project status and gauging client satisfaction.
  • Manage the project schedule, budget, and documentation.
  • Create subcontracts and prepare purchase orders.
  • Develop scope and RFQ packages for subcontractors and vendors.
  • Support the Project Superintendent to ensure adherence to contract documents / requirements.
  • Provide oversight of supporting staff; including interviewing and training associates, and planning, assigning, and directing work.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.

The Successful Applicant

The Project Manager will have :

  • Minimum of 3 years of experience as a Project Engineer or 5 years of experience as Project Manager. with an associate degree in a related field.
  • Previous Multifamily and PT / Podium Deck / Parking Garage work is a plus
  • OSHA 30-hour certification.
  • LEED GA or AP preferred.
  • Proficient in MS Office, Primavera P6, and ProCore.
  • General knowledge of Construction Management and Design / Build contract delivery systems.
  • Well-organized, detail-oriented, and structured work habits.
  • Demonstrated ability to direct, organize, and communicate with people of all levels and personalities.
  • Ability to read and understand contracts, blueprints, construction project schedules, and scopes of work.
  • Ability to successfully manage moderately complex projects.
